Product reviews:
Lennon
2026-03-14 iphone 11 Pro
Plush Brown Teddy Bear good stuff nfl teddy bears
good stuff nfl teddy bears
Lewis
2026-03-14 iphone SE
NFL Falcons Plush Stuffed Teddy Bear good stuff nfl teddy bears
good stuff nfl teddy bears
Gregary
2026-03-18 iphone 7 Plus
The Good Stuff NFL Green Bay Packers good stuff nfl teddy bears
good stuff nfl teddy bears